asked 07/20/18When the reciprocal of the larger of two consecutive even integers
is subtracted from 4 times the reciprocal of the smaller, the result is 5/6. Find the integers.

Translate the question into an equation:
[4/(2k)] - [1/(2k+2)] = 5/6
(4/k) - [1/(k + 1) = 5/3
3(4k + 4 -k) = 5k(k+1) => 12k + 12 - 3k = 5k2 + 5k
5k2 - 4k - 12 = 0
(5k + 6)(k-2) = 0
The negative root is extraneous and k =2.
The integers are 4 and 6.
You should check that they make sense in the original statement of the problem.
